The Heartbeat of Fitness at the Holyoke YMCA
So, what exactly does a Physical Director at the YMCA in Holyoke do? It's a pretty comprehensive role, honestly. First off, they're the visionaries for our fitness programs. This means they're not just organizing existing classes; they're constantly thinking about new and innovative ways to keep our members engaged and challenged. Whether it's setting up a new yoga series, designing a cutting-edge HIIT workout, or ensuring our senior fitness classes are accessible and effective, they're at the forefront. They analyze trends, consider the needs of our diverse community, and then craft programs that deliver real results. It's about creating a holistic approach to fitness, one that caters to all ages and fitness levels. This involves a lot of research, planning, and, of course, a deep understanding of exercise science. They need to know what works, why it works, and how to adapt it for different individuals.
Beyond program design, they are also the guardians of our fitness facilities. This means ensuring all our equipment is in top-notch condition, safe to use, and readily available. Ever seen a broken treadmill or a dusty set of weights? Well, that's not on their watch! They oversee maintenance, inspect equipment regularly, and make sure the entire gym environment is clean, welcoming, and conducive to a great workout. This attention to detail is vital for preventing injuries and ensuring members have a positive experience every time they walk through the door. Think of them as the ultimate facility managers, but with a laser focus on fitness. They manage budgets for equipment upgrades, coordinate repairs, and often work with vendors to get the best deals. Their goal is always to provide a high-quality, safe, and inspiring environment for everyone.

A Day in the Life: More Than Just Workouts
Let's peel back the curtain a bit and imagine a typical day for our Physical Director at the YMCA in Holyoke, Massachusetts. It's definitely not just about counting reps or shouting encouragement, though there's plenty of that! It usually starts early, often with equipment checks and setting up for the first wave of morning classes. They might be leading a boot camp session, followed by meeting with a member to discuss their personal fitness goals. Then, it's likely a session dedicated to program development – perhaps researching new fitness trends, planning the upcoming youth sports schedule, or collaborating with other YMCA staff on community outreach events.
Lunch might be a quick bite while reviewing member feedback or responding to emails about class registrations. The afternoon could involve supervising the gym floor, ensuring safety protocols are followed, and providing guidance to members. They might also be training new fitness instructors, ensuring they meet the YMCA's high standards for quality and safety. There's a constant juggle between hands-on leadership, administrative tasks, and strategic planning. They are the problem-solvers, the motivators, and the organizers, all rolled into one. They have to be adaptable, ready to handle unexpected situations, and always focused on providing the best possible experience for every single person who walks through the YMCA doors.
